Requisition ID:65286
ABOUT WHIRLPOOL CORPORATION
Whirlpool Corporation (NYSE: WHR) is a leading kitchen and laundry appliance company, in constant pursuit of improving life at home and inspiring generations with our brands. The company is driving meaningful innovation to meet the evolving needs of consumers through its iconic brand portfolio, including Whirlpool, KitchenAid, JennAir, Maytag, Amana, Brastemp, Consul, and InSinkErator. In 2023, the company reported approximately $19 billion in annual sales, 59,000 employees, and 55 manufacturing and technology research centers. Additional information about the company can be found at WhirlpoolCorp.com.
The team you will be a part of
ORGANIZATION
THE GLOBAL BUSINESS:
#1 Fortune 500 Company in Consumer Durable category
Annual sales turnover of $21 billion
70 Manufacturing & Technology centers around the Globe
Operations in more than 170 countries
Over 12 brands as part of global portfolio
BEST EMPLOYER AWARD
We believe that our people make us a great place to work, reflected in the awards we have received consistently over the past couple of years.
This role in summary
Delivery of software for embedded systems and associated software tools for all Whirlpool products
Your responsibilities will include
Work with peers and supervisors to deliver software with high quality, in accordance with approved requirements.
Ensure successful development and maintenance in at least one software component within the EES software component repository.
Work with the project manager to plan the delivery of software with the project's delivery requirements and defined cadence.
Apply project management and work package management techniques
Work with V&V team to diagnose and then fix issues identified during testing, and to improve testing; respond to critical and major issues on priority; analyze bug trends, capture knowledge, and drive long-term improvements
Drive best practices for software development.
Keeps abreast of the latest developments in software technologies, tools, processes, etc.
Provide technical leadership in at least one software areas (e.g., RTOS, HMI, IoT, PC-based tools, AI/ML, etc.)
Solve technical problems within the product category software team
Prepare and maintain quality documentation of owned software, mentor junior engineers in documentation
Lead technical design and code reviews
Provide timely feedback to engineers and managers
Mentor and lead other software engineers.
Minimum requirements
EDUCATIONAL QUALIFICATIONS
AGE
EXP
B.E. / B.Tech. in Electronics / E&TC / relevant field; preferred specialization in Embedded Systems
NA
BE 6-10 yrs, ME 5-8 yrs
Preferred skills and experiences
Leadership in delivery of embedded software features towards the successful delivery of projects
Software module architecture following requirements; unit test plans
Project plan, dashboards, and metrics
Architecture reuse plan and Integration
Support for builds and internal integration events
Communication and close interaction with external process partners - third party vendors as needed
Documentation of implemented software
Mentorship of team members
Contribution to increased team capabilities through ideas, proofs-of-concept, Continuous Improvement projects, etc.
Contribution to hiring activities
Additional information
Proficiency in C/C++ programming for embedded systems
Knowledge of microprocessor/microcontroller architecture, hardware basics
Knowledge of communication protocols such as CAN, I2C, SPI, UART, etc.
Understanding of the principles in relevant software area (e.g., RTOS, HMI, PC-based tools, Arduino / Raspberry Pi, etc.)
Experience in UML/SysML modeling languages
Strong verification, testing, and debugging concepts
Hands-on experience with development and debugging tools
Connect with us and learn more about Whirlpool Corporation
See what it's like to work at Whirlpool by visiting Whirlpool Careers. Additional information about the company can be found on Facebook, Twitter,LinkedIn ,Instagram andYouTube .
At Whirlpool Corporation, we value and celebrate diversity. Whirlpool Corporation is committed to equal employment opportunity and prohibits any discrimination on the basis of race or ethnicity, religion, sex, pregnancy, gender expression or identity, sexual orientation, age, physical or mental disability, veteran status, or any other category protected by applicable law.